events (read deployment-event history)

cdkd events <stack> reads back the structured deployment events cdkd records for every cdkd deploy / cdkd destroy run — cdkd's local equivalent of CloudFormation's DescribeStackEvents. Events are persisted as JSONL under a deployments/ key family separate from state.json (no state schema bump), so a destroyed stack's failure history stays readable. Event recording is best-effort and never blocks the deploy / destroy; events carry error + metadata only (never resource properties).

cdkd events MyStack                       # list runs, newest first
cdkd events MyStack --run <runId>         # one run's full event stream
cdkd events MyStack --format json         # machine-readable JSON (or --json)
cdkd events MyStack --stack-region <r>    # disambiguate multi-region history

events prune (purge old event history)

The store self-bounds to the last 20 runs at write time, but cdkd destroy deliberately keeps event history as post-mortem context, so it never returns the bucket to empty on its own. cdkd events prune <stack> is the explicit purge:

cdkd events prune MyStack                 # keep the newest 20 (default)
cdkd events prune MyStack --keep 5        # keep the newest 5
cdkd events prune MyStack --older-than 24h# delete runs older than 24h
cdkd events prune MyStack --all           # purge everything (+ the index)
cdkd events prune MyStack --all --yes     # skip the confirmation (CI)

--all is mutually exclusive with --keep / --older-than. With both --keep and --older-than, a run is deleted only when it is BOTH beyond the newest-N window AND older than the cutoff. Prompts for confirmation unless -y / --yes; --stack-region disambiguates a multi-region stack.

State-driven (no synth, no lock). See docs/deployment-events.md for the full reference: event types, S3 key layout, flush strategy, index.json semantics, and the retention model.
